    Researchers break Newton’s third law

    It really is a nice and legitimate experiment but it doesn't make a Dean drive work. This takes place inside of an optical lattice (an artificial crystal), negative masses are nothing peculiar there (the effective mass corresponds to the curvature of the dispersion relationship).     discussion: are there any places that complex numbers are necessary?

    I just want to point out what has already been said earlier: AFAIK in classical physics (that is mechanics, electrodynamics and relativity) complex numbers are just handy but not strictly necessary. All the physical quantities, that can be measured, are real. Quantum mechanics, however, would...
